During labor, pregnancy, and delivery, a variety of things can go wrong. If these events occur because of medical negligence, they may cause birth injuries that alter the life of a family for ever. Based on the severity of the injury, a claim could involve both economic and non-economic damages. Economic damages include hospital bills as well as prescriptions and therapy costs as well as lost wages. Non-economic damages could include the emotional, physical and mental pain that the family has to endure due to the birth injury.

Despite the best efforts of nurses, doctors and other medical personnel there is a chance that a patient may be the victim of a preventable birth injury. Hospitals must adhere to certain standards. If a doctor does not meet the standards of care, it's considered medical malpractice.

A doctor may not react promptly when a baby's heartbeat drops or if they give the incorrect medication. They may also use wrong forceps or vacuum to deliver the baby or make an error. If any of these errors cause permanent harm and cause permanent harm, a birth injury lawsuit could be filed.

A majority of these claims are filed against the liable healthcare provider's insurance company. It is essential to employ an attorney with expertise working with insurance companies. They can help you to negotiate a settlement that will cover all of your damages.

Premature births - Babies born prior to 37 weeks are more likely to suffer serious birth injuries due to their premature muscles, brains and organs. Atlanta's rate of premature birth is the highest of any city in the United States and earned it an "F" from the March of Dimes.

Cerebral palsy - This group of disorders causes a range of symptoms that affect motor skills and coordination. It is typically caused by oxygen deprivation during birth, and could be due to the doctor not performing C-sections, using excessive force when delivering or not observing the mother for signs of distress.

Oxygen deprivation during labor and delivery is one of the most common birth injuries. This can result in brain damage and cerebral paralysis. It is crucial that your doctor responds quickly to any signs of fetal stress.

It could also be a case medical malpractice if the doctor does not communicate properly with the other members of the team supporting you throughout the delivery process and something "slips through the cracks."

The amount of your claim will be determined by various factors that include economic and non-economic damages. Economic damages include past, future, and current medical expenses, prescriptions, therapy lost wages, if you were unable work due to injuries sustained by your child, and other economic losses. Non-economic damages include your child's pain and suffering as well as the loss of enjoyment from life, mental stress, and other intangible losses. Our Atlanta birth injury lawyers know how to determine your damages and will battle tirelessly against the insurance company to ensure that you get fair compensation. In some instances, punitive or exemplary damages may be awarded if the liable party's actions were negligent or reckless, or malicious.

A legal claim against a negligent healthcare professional demands evidence of several factors. First, the medical professional must have a duty of care to the mother and child during pregnancy, labor, and birth. This includes following the national guidelines and guidelines. Then, there is a causality. This means that the breach of the duty of the doctor directly caused the birth injury. This is typically proven by expert testimony.

Damages are another important factor. The plaintiff must have suffered compensable damages as a result, such as loss of income, ongoing medical treatment, therapy, or emotional anguish. Punitive or exemplary damages can also be awarded in cases when the healthcare professional responsible for the injury's conduct is particularly shocking or outrageous.
